The CYP27A1 antibody is a crucial tool for studying the enzyme cytochrome P450 family 27 subfamily A member 1 (CYP27A1), a mitochondrial protein involved in cholesterol metabolism and bile acid synthesis. CYP27A1 catalyzes the hydroxylation of cholesterol to form 27-hydroxycholesterol, a key step in the alternative pathway of bile acid production. It also plays a role in vitamin D3 activation by converting vitamin D3 to 25-hydroxyvitamin D3. Mutations in the CYP27A1 gene are linked to cerebrotendinous xanthomatosis (CTX), a rare autosomal recessive disorder characterized by abnormal cholesterol and cholestanol accumulation in tissues, leading to neurological, ocular, and cardiovascular complications.
CYP27A1 antibodies are widely used in research to detect protein expression, localization, and regulation in tissues such as the liver, brain, and vascular endothelium. These antibodies enable techniques like Western blotting, immunohistochemistry (IHC), and immunofluorescence (IF) to investigate CYP27A1's role in metabolic pathways, disease mechanisms, and potential therapeutic targets. Polyclonal and monoclonal variants are available, often validated for specificity in human, mouse, or rat models. Studies using these antibodies have clarified CYP27A1's involvement in atherosclerosis, neurodegenerative diseases, and cancer, highlighting its dual role in lipid homeostasis and inflammation. Reliable detection of CYP27A1 aids in diagnosing CTX and understanding its pathophysiology.
